Chimney Sweeping in Los Angeles, CA
Chimney sweeping services involve the thorough cleaning of a fireplace or stove chimney to remove soot, creosote buildup, and debris that can accumulate over time. This process helps maintain proper airflow, enhances the efficiency of heating appliances, and reduces the risk of chimney fires. Projects typically include cleaning residential fireplaces, wood stoves, and other venting systems, ensuring that they operate safely and effectively throughout the heating season.
Homeowners considering chimney sweeping should understand that the service often involves inspecting the entire chimney system for blockages, damage, or signs of wear. It's common to request this service before the start of colder months or after heavy use to prevent potential hazards. Property owners may also want to inquire about the scope of cleaning, the need for repairs, or any additional maintenance that could improve the safety and performance of their heating systems.

Chimney Sweeping Questions
How often should a chimney be swept? It is recommended to have the chimney inspected and swept at least once a year to ensure safe and efficient operation.
What are common signs that a chimney needs cleaning? Signs include smoke backup, a strong odor, soot buildup, or visible obstructions in the chimney.
Can chimney sweeping improve fireplace performance? Yes, removing creosote and debris can enhance airflow and reduce the risk of fire hazards.
Is chimney sweeping necessary even if the fireplace is rarely used? Yes, regular cleaning helps prevent buildup of creosote and other deposits that can accumulate over time.
